Description
Karin Björquist for Gustavsberg, set of three teacups with saucers, "Kobolt". Iconic cylindrical porcelain tea service with deep cobalt blue glaze and white horizontal stripe decoration. Kobolt model designed with functionalist Swedish modernist aesthetics. Origin: Sweden. Designer: Karin Björquist. Material: Porcelain. Dimensions: Cups: H. 6 cm, D. 12 cm. Saucers: D. 15 cm. Period: 1970s. Condition: Excellent condition with minor signs of wear. Bio: Karin Björquist (1927-2018) was a Swedish ceramicist and designer, renowned for her pioneering work at Gustavsberg, where she created a number of functional and timeless porcelain series. Her design language combined practical usability with Scandinavian modernist aesthetics, making her work enduring classics of Swedish design.
